These sessions are to brief Principals/school leaders, e-learning
coordinators and teachers who are interested to have their schools
participate in the ANSN Interactive Whiteboard Hub in 2010.
The purpose of the sessions is to demonstrate the potential of
Interactive Whiteboards in the classroom and explain what is offered
in the Hub's comprehensive 5-day, action research-based professional
development training, which will be spread throughout 2010.
Membership of the Hub also gives schools the opportunity to purchase
Promethean Activ boards at a reduced price negotiated by the ANSN.
Over the last three years, approximately 300 teachers have taken
part in the program. If you would like to learn more about some of
